EXIN AICP Exam Summary:
| Exam Name | EXIN Artificial Intelligence Compliance Professional |
| Exam Code | AICP |
| Exam Price | $311 (USD) |
| Duration | 90 mins |
| Number of Questions | 40 |
| Passing Score | 65% |

EXIN Artificial Intelligence Compliance Professional Exam Syllabus Topics:
| Topic | Details | Weights |
|---|---|---|
| Context of the AI Act | 5% | |
| Purpose and scope |
The candidate can… - explain the primary objectives of the AI Act. - understand the scope of the AI Act. - explain the different roles defined in the AI Act. |
5% |
| AI Act in depth | 37.5% | |
| Key provisions |
The candidate can… - classify an AI system into one of the categories: unacceptable risk, high risk, limited risk, minimal or no risk. - identify the requirements for high-risk AI systems. - identify the relevant governance and oversight for AI systems. |
15% |
| Risks and regulations |
The candidate can… - analyze the balance between innovation and regulation in the AI Act. - explain general purpose AI, systemic risks, and code of practices. - identify the implications of the AI Act on intellectual property (IP) rights. - explain the benefits and drawbacks of using open-source models versus closed-source models under the AI Act. - understand AI-provider obligations: conducting conformity assessments, maintaining documentation, notifying regulators. |
10% |
| Compliance and enforcement |
The candidate can… - explain the implications of accountability and compliance. - describe the process of incident reporting and response. - describe the importance of whistleblowers for AI systems. - identify the correct penalties for the different types of non-compliance: noncompliance with bans, violating high-risk requirements, lesser breaches. - understand AI-user obligations: using the AI systems as intended, monitoring system performance, and reporting issues. |
12.5% |
| Trustworthy AI | 12.5% | |
| Privacy and data protection |
The candidate can… - understand why data management and privacy are important. - apply GDPR principles to a given data protection scenario. - analyze the implications of data minimization in AI systems. |
7.5% |
| Transparency and traceability |
The candidate can… - understand the importance of transparency in AI systems. - understand the role of transparency in fostering public trust in AI systems. - explain the importance of traceability in AI systems. |
5% |
| Ethical AI | 10% | |
| Principles and guidelines |
The candidate can… - identify key ethical principles in AI development. - interpret the AI Act's guidelines on ethical AI deployment in a scenario. |
5% |
| Human rights |
The candidate can… - understand the importance of human oversight in AI systems as mandated by the AI Act. - identify the rights of individuals affected by AI systems under the AI Act by doing a fundamental rights impact assessment. |
5% |
| AI Act in practice | 15% | |
| AI in the public sector |
The candidate can… - understand the risks of introducing AI systems in public domains: public decision making, crime prosecution, elections. |
2.5% |
| AI in the private sector |
The candidate can… - analyze the impact of the AI Act on different stakeholders: finance and insurance. - analyze the impact of the AI Act on different stakeholders: healthcare. - analyze the impact of the AI Act on different stakeholders: employment and education. - analyze the impact of the AI Act on different stakeholders: autonomous driving. - analyze the impact of the AI Act on different stakeholders: advertising and tourism. |
12.5% |
| Frameworks to support compliance | 20% | |
| European standards |
The candidate can… - understand how the CEN/CLC/TR 18115 will help a business implement data governance practices that comply with Article 10 of the AI Act. |
5% |
| International standards |
The candidate can… - understand how the ISO/IEC 42001 standard and the NIST framework will help a business ensure the responsible development and use of AI. - understand how the ISO/IEC 23894 standard will help a business to integrate risk management practices specifically related to AI in their AI-related activities. - understand ethical issues surrounding AI development and usage from the ISO/IEC TR 24368 standard. |
15% |
